This year's dates for the World Fireworks Championship Blackpool have been revealed. 

Three countries will take part over alternate Saturdays on September 17, October 1 and October 15. 

The stunning displays are free to access and the draw for this year's competing countries will be announced over the coming months. 

The firework displays are set to music on the beach with the backdrop of The Blackpool Tower.

Cllr Lynn Williams, Leader of Blackpool Council, said: “These are free family events that are hugely popular with residents and visitors alike.

“Moving the displays from Fridays to Saturdays proved hugely successful last year, giving people more time to come into the centre of Blackpool during the daytime and enjoy some of the many other attractions on offer before watching the firework displays.

“It’s a winning formula and we can’t wait to bring the sheer spectacle of the World Fireworks Championship Blackpool to the seafront this coming autumn.”

VisitBlackpool has already announced an extended Illuminations season starting on Friday2 September and running through to January 2, 2023.
